Outline of Final Research Achievements |
All of the fluvial deposits and adjacent topography have been attributed to the function of flowing river water in science education of Japan. Recently it is revealed that those of the upper stream are formed mainly with debris flow. In this study, the concept of debris flow is introduced into the science education, and the range predominated by flowing water is restricted based on the data by measuring with newly developed electromagnetic velocimeter. Accounting the variation of debris flows occurred in various geology, tectonism and climate, teaching materials using aerial and satellite photography and modeling laboratory instrument are developed. They are evaluated through application by many elementary and high school teachers.
